    If this is a standard pre-employment (5 panel) hydrocodone will not show up. This is due to the sensitivity of panels used. Pre-employment can test only for illegal drugs and not prescription per ADA rules.

    That changes once you are offered the position.

    There is one problem with hydrocodone. While it cannot be identified on a 5 - panel it can cause a false positive for opiates.
